Qualitative Market Researcher salary in Norway

Average Yearly Salary of Qualitative Market Researcher in Norway is approximately 1,089,020 NOK (98,763 USD). Data is for 2025 and indicates a pre-tax value. The salary itself depends on multiple factors such as seniority, job performance, certifications, experience or any other bonuses. The value indicated is an average amount based on records we have in database. Real values may vary. The data is for orientational purposes.

What does Qualitative Market Researcher do?

occupation personasA qualitative market researcher is responsible for conducting in-depth research to gather insights and understanding of consumer behavior, preferences, and opinions. They use various qualitative research methods such as focus groups, interviews, and observation to collect data and analyze it to generate meaningful findings. This occupation involves designing research studies, developing interview guides, moderating group discussions, analyzing data, and preparing reports with actionable recommendations for clients.

Skills: qualitative research, market research, consumer behavior, data analysis, focus groups, interview techniques
Job industry: Marketing

Salary increase per years of experience

Based on data available the salary increase per years of experience is as following

    0 years (beginner) equals base salary
    1 to 5 years of experience yields up arrow+12% salary increase
    6 to 10 years of experience yields up arrow+25% salary increase
    11 to 15 years of experience yields up arrow+16% salary increase
    16 to 25 years of experience yields up arrow+9% salary increase
    more than 25 years of experience yields up arrow+10% salary increase
NOTE: Details based on limited set of data. Percentages may vary. The salary increase over years of experience can vary widely based on factors such as job industry, job role, location, company size, and individual performance.
